Extended RV travelers are those who spend weeks and even months traveling and living in their RV. Unlike weekend and vacation RVers, though, the extended RV traveler can not just put their lives on hold while they are away from home, and then play catch-up when they return. Life goes on while they are on the road.

Arrangements have to be made to secure their home, receive their mail, pay their bills, and keep in touch with their friends and families. Extended RV travelers may also have to deal with obtaining medical care and getting their prescriptions refilled while thousands of miles from home.

In "Extended RV Travel", Joe and Vicki Kieva, who have been extended RV travelers since 1989, deal with these subjects and answer the questions most frequently asked by those who are about to go on the road for extended periods of time.
